The Philippines reveals democracy’s digital paradox. The Marcos administration, which rose to power through disinformation campaigns, now attempts to counter pro-Duterte disinformation networks using legal apparatus. Yet the administration lacks credibility, having shunned debates and maintained symbiotic relationships with paid vloggers. While state power confronts digital networks, compelling Duterte content around his ICC arrest outperforms policy-focused Marcos rallies. Two liberal senators’ midterm success offers hope, but the broader question remains whether democracy survives when both sides embrace disinformation.
